Series Overview
Son of a Critch is a heartwarming Canadian comedy that transports viewers to 1980s Newfoundland, capturing the trials of growing up through the eyes of a young boy who feels much older than his eleven years. Based on the real-life memoirs of comedian Mark Critch, the series offers a nostalgic and funny window into adolescence. The plot centers on Mark Critch, portrayed by the talented Benjamin Evan Ainsworth, as he endures the complications of family life, strict Catholic school, and the awkwardness of youthful romance. Despite his age, Mark possesses a maturity that allows him to use comedy to connect with the small collection of people in his limited world. The cast features remarkable performances, including Mark Critch himself playing his own father, alongside Claire Rankin, who brings depth to the family dynamic.
